Somalia: Bomb blast wounds University lecturer in Mogadishu

Image

MOGADISHU, Somalia- A bomb fitted into a car has critically wounded a university lecturer in the capital of Mogadishu, on Tuesday, Garowe Online reports.

An eyewitness, who asked to remain anonymous, told GO that the car exploded outside Sei Piano building located in Hodan district.

The university lecturer who was identified as Abdiweli Baadi Mohamed has sustained injures from the bomb explosion, and rushed to a nearby hospital for a treatment.

Reports said the wounded professor is working with former CRD head Jibril Ibrahim Abdulle, who is currently a presidential candidate running for presidency in 2016 elections.

Three people bystanders were reportedly got injured from the bomb blast and no group has claimed responsibility for the attack.

The attack is thought to be carried out by Al Shabaab militants group, as they intensified sporadic attacks in the capital Mogadishu recently.
